请教:新建task和mmi task消息发送接收问题!
时间:10-02
整理:3721RD
点击:
我最近碰到在展讯6600L上遇到一个问题:
我创建了一个task,从mmi task上发送消息到我自建的task上,消息接收处理正常。但是从我自建的task发消息到mmi task时,mmi task一直收不到该的消息。
我的具体做法是:在APP_Init函数里面调用一个mmi_msg_init函数,具体实现是:
void mmi_msg_init(void)
{
g_app.ProcessMsg = mmi_msg_handle;
g_app.component_type = CT_APPLICATION;
}其中mmi_msg_handle函数是对我创建的task 发到mmi task的消息处理函数。整个过程我是参照了展讯其他模块类似的处理。
请各位高手指点一下!谢谢!
我创建了一个task,从mmi task上发送消息到我自建的task上,消息接收处理正常。但是从我自建的task发消息到mmi task时,mmi task一直收不到该的消息。
我的具体做法是:在APP_Init函数里面调用一个mmi_msg_init函数,具体实现是:
void mmi_msg_init(void)
{
g_app.ProcessMsg = mmi_msg_handle;
g_app.component_type = CT_APPLICATION;
}其中mmi_msg_handle函数是对我创建的task 发到mmi task的消息处理函数。整个过程我是参照了展讯其他模块类似的处理。
请各位高手指点一下!谢谢!
需要mmi task注册该消息!